Common Challenges of Infrastructure Leakage

Concrete is widely used in infrastructure, but its porous nature and tendency to crack under stress make it vulnerable to water infiltration. For contractors and engineers, the most common leakage challenges include:

  • Tunnels and Subways: Constant groundwater pressure leads to water ingress through cracks and joints.
  • Basements and Underground Facilities: Continuous seepage causes mold, corrosion, and structural weakening.
  • Bridges and Highways: Exposure to rainwater and de-icing salts accelerates deterioration.
  • Dams and Reservoirs: High hydrostatic pressure creates persistent leakage, jeopardizing long-term performance.

Traditional solutions often fail because they cannot fully penetrate micro-cracks or withstand aggressive chemical environments. Downtime during repair projects further complicates the situation, especially for large-scale infrastructure works where operational delays are costly.

Penetration Advantages of Polyurea Grouting Fluid

Polyurea grouting fluid addresses these challenges with its low viscosity and high penetration capability. Unlike cement-based grout, which often remains on the surface of cracks, polyurea easily infiltrates deep into micro-cracks and porous structures.

  • Capillary Action: The fluid flows into the tiniest voids, ensuring complete sealing of leakage pathways.
  • Permanent Filling: Once cured, the polyurea forms a dense and elastic barrier that adapts to structural movements.
  • Reliable Waterproofing: It eliminates the risk of water bypassing the injection point, which is common in traditional systems.

This makes polyurea particularly valuable for underground projects like metro systems and mining shafts, where leakage originates from micro-cracks invisible to the naked eye.

Fast Curing and Strong Bonding Performance

One of the key benefits of polyurea grouting fluid is its rapid curing time. In large-scale projects, downtime must be minimized, and polyurea allows repair works to be completed quickly.

  • Fast Set Time: Depending on the formulation, curing occurs within hours, enabling structures to return to service almost immediately.
  • Strong Adhesion: The material bonds tightly with concrete surfaces, ensuring long-term durability even under dynamic loads.
  • Reduced Labor Costs: Contractors save both time and manpower, making projects more cost-efficient.

This combination of speed and bonding strength is crucial for infrastructure owners and contractors aiming to maintain operational continuity without compromising safety.

Long-Term Waterproofing and Chemical Resistance

Infrastructure often operates in harsh environments where exposure to aggressive chemicals, saltwater, or acidic soils can accelerate deterioration. Polyurea grouting fluid is specifically designed to withstand these conditions.

  • Waterproof Durability: Once cured, it creates a continuous, elastic waterproof membrane that resists hydrostatic pressure.
  • Chemical Resistance: Its formulation resists acids, alkalis, and chloride attacks, making it suitable for industrial zones, tunnels, and coastal structures.
  • Extended Service Life: By protecting against both water and chemical intrusion, it reduces the frequency of future maintenance.

For example, in coastal bridges or underground tunnels exposed to chloride-rich groundwater, polyurea ensures that the concrete remains intact and functional for decades.

1: What makes polyurea grouting fluid different from cement-based grout?

Unlike cement-based grout, polyurea has low viscosity, penetrates micro-cracks, and cures quickly, creating a long-lasting waterproof barrier.

2: Can polyurea grouting fluid be used in active water leakage conditions?

Yes, polyurea reacts even in the presence of water, making it ideal for tunnels, dams, and basements experiencing active leakage.

3: How long does polyurea grouting fluid last?

With proper application, polyurea provides waterproofing protection for decades, significantly reducing maintenance costs.

4: Is polyurea grouting fluid safe for drinking water structures?

Special formulations are available that comply with international safety standards, making them suitable for potable water applications.
